Invasion Update

I just got off the phone with my friend, Debbie.... the one who has bladder cancer.

She had surgery today and it is all good news! The surgeon said he removed the tumour cleanly and there was only the one. Plus it was superficial, meaning it had not invaded the muscle of the bladder wall. So detection was early and eradication was swift.

At this point, it is not officially known if it is cancerous but the surgeon felt it was, by it's appearance and his experience with these types of tumours. It has been sent to the lab for biopsy. He was quite confident that it was removed early enough that chemo or radiation may not be necessary. She will be followed regularly and closely, however, given the family history.
